Hardwood: tactile, repairable, and truthful regarding its needs

Real lumber is the material that forgives you if you appreciate it. It will dent as opposed to chip, age as opposed to day, and it can be fined sand back to fresh grain when trends or renters have actually had their means. It also requires security and attention to moisture.

Solid versus crafted wood is the initial fork. Strong oak, identified gum, or blackbutt feels timeless, takes several sands, and matches duration renovations. But it moves. Slabs expand with humidity and contract when the heating unit runs hard for 6 weeks. Over lumber joists, a well repaired solid floor that's accustomed on website sings underfoot. On concrete, it calls for battens or a full glue-down with a dampness obstacle that actually functions, not simply a sheet of plastic padding. Engineered hardwood includes a plywood core that limits motion. If the home has a hydronic slab or if you want bigger boards in a space with morning sunlight, crafted is your insurance policy.

On price, hardwood mounted by a qualified flooring layer rests at the premium end. Materials differ extensively: Australian types can run from moderate to costly, imported oaks often come in sharper if gotten well. Setup style matters just as much. A glue-down to piece with proper wetness reduction is slower and more expensive than a click-together drifting system, but it really feels strong, minimizes tramp echo, and enhances resale. Purchasers in Melbourne understand and will pay for real hardwood done right.

The most usual mistake with wood here is hurrying adjustment. I have measured 14 percent moisture content in wood provided to a home where the slab went to 5.5 percent moisture by weight. Place that down on Monday, run ducted home heating on Wednesday, and by Friday you have actually got gapping you can go down a bank card right into. The repair is boring: shop boards in the real spaces for a number of days, aerate, and measure with a calibrated meter till lumber and home concur. Boring works.

When you desire hardwood to take on life, the surface gains its maintain. Hardwax oil lets wood take a breath and is repairable in patches, which suits family members who accept the odd scrape and wish to preserve locally. Polyurethane, waterborne or solvent-based, develops a tougher film and stands up to discoloration much better, yet repair work are much less unseen. Inquire about luster and slip. Too glossy floors look elegant at handover and after that show every impact in a Brunswick leasing. Satin or extra-matte reads modern-day, hides a lot more, and mirrors less glow via those tall Victorian windows.

Laminate: resilient print, smart rate, and remarkably great looking

Twenty years ago I stayed clear of laminate unless budget plans were brutal. These days, much better products with deep embossed textures mislead the eye and underfoot they satisfy. The wear layer, a melamine-based overlay, shrugs off chair legs and youngsters' mobility scooters much better than many site-finished polyurethane. The photographic layer underneath captures oak, herringbone, even concrete. It is straightforward concerning being a picture, not a slice of tree, which releases you to go darker or lighter without the upkeep penalties real wood would certainly bring.

Laminate is typically drifted over padding. That implies quicker mount and much less irreversible commitment. If you are leasing the building, or you anticipate to renovate the kitchen area later, a floating laminate allows you dismantle and pass on without grinding adhesive off a piece. However laminate's weakness is edge wetness. A dishwashing machine leakage that sits over night can swell the HDF core, and blew sides do not unpuff. Some costs laminates have waxed joints and far better core densities that postpone that failure, but absolutely nothing beats wiping up the spill in minutes.

Underlay option matters. An active townhouse benefits from a denser acoustic padding since stairwells and difficult surfaces intensify noise. In houses, lots of proprietors corporations impose minimal acoustic scores. A trusted flooring layer Melbourne strata managers have actually handled in the past will certainly recognize which examination reports count and which underlays in fact do on a concrete piece. Cheap foam rug feels agreeable the very first week, after that presses and transfers clicky footprints through the framework. Invest the additional 10 dollars per square meter and conserve your neighbor a complaint letter.

Sunlight discolor is much less of a problem with laminate than with hardwood, simply since the surface area does not oxidize the same way. That claimed, some prints can wash out at north-facing sliders if you never use blinds. Strategy the design to minimize end-joint clustering where the sun strikes toughest. A few rotating rugs aid, and so does a UV-protective film on huge panes. On maintenance, laminate requests very little. Avoid vapor mops and sopping wet cleaning; a damp microfiber pad with a neutral option keeps the surface area looking sharp.

Hybrid: the dampness wrestler with rock-solid stability

Hybrid boards answer a Melbourne classic: a wood look that pokes fun at wet boots by the back entrance. The majority of hybrid items integrate a plastic or stone-polymer composite core with a hard wear layer and a click profile. They do incline a wiped floor or a dog dish that splashes daily. They move really little with moisture and temperature changes, which aids when the cooking area obtains wintertime sun and the corridor does not.

Hybrids are drifted also, generally with pre-attached rug. They really feel different underfoot than timber. There is a density and a small strength that some individuals love and others discover as less "active." The better hybrids tamp down drum audio, yet more affordable ones can seem hollow if the subfloor is not flat. That monotony requirement catches numerous DIYs. The spec sheets normally enable 2 to 3 millimeters deviation over 2 meters. A slab patch at the back entrance or a tiny hump over a pipeline chase will telegraph as a click or a flex. A specialist floor layer in Melbourne will certainly spend as long prepping the piece as they do laying the boards, because that is what divides a floor you ignore from a floor you promise at.

Edge securing is one more crossbreed nuance. Numerous brands tout "water resistant," which describes the board material, not your room. Water can still locate its means via border development gaps and under skirting, after that rest there and scent like a failed to remember beach towel. In wet areas outside rigorous shower room zones, a careful grain at transitions and a wise selection on door trims conserves frustrations. I have actually seen lavatory with hybrid stand proud after a commode overflow because we secured the perimeter and specified a somewhat raised change strip that imitated a rate bump for water.

Thermal habits is worthy of a word. Hybrids deal with induction heat better than laminate generally, but check the optimum surface area temperature rating. The majority of products cap at around 27 levels Celsius. If your hydronic slab pushes hotter, bring that up prior to set up. Direct lunchtime sunlight on a little, glazed box area can surge surface area temps above that number also without underfloor home heating. Strategic mats, exterior shading, or just a timer on the blinds can keep the flooring inside its convenience zone.

The subfloor makes a decision more than the showroom does

Before speaking shade and plank width, a floor layer tests, taps, and actions. On concrete, we inspect moisture with either in-slab probes or loved one humidity sleeves. A fresh poured piece can hold moisture for months. Also an old piece can pull ground moisture if the vapor barrier under your home is endangered. In one Preston develop, the slab was twenty years of ages yet sat over a yard bed that embraced the exterior wall surface. The soil line rested greater than the piece side, pressing dampness sideways. Without a topical vapor obstacle under glue, the glue bond would certainly have fallen short by winter months. We applied a two-part epoxy dampness obstacle and mosted likely to a glue-down crafted oak. Ten years later, it still checks out solid.

Timber subfloors inform their own story. Old joists typically befall of degree by 10 to 15 millimeters across an area. Putting a floating system over that wave will produce a springboard near the low point. Packing and planing is slow-moving job, and it is not extravagant, yet it pays back every time you walk that area. Squeaks originate from motion, and movement originates from gaps or loosened dealing with. Include screws where the builder made use of nails, resecure loose particleboard, and you eliminate that future nuisance. A good floor layer Melbourne renovators work with will certainly quote prep plainly so you are not shocked, since preparation is where tasks go right.

Acoustics belong in the subfloor discussion as well. In double-story homes with plaster ceilings listed below, footfall on stiff floors can feel loud. Much heavier glue-down wood reduces that compared to floating systems. If you like a floating set up for budget or flexibility, a thick rubber-cork rug transforms the area. Measure influence noise in the downstairs room after mounting a test patch if you are sensitive to sound. It is less expensive than a redo.

Color, size, and how spaces take care of time

Wide planks look upscale in images and if the flooring takes it, they are sensational. On a busy slab or an unpredictable environment, bigger boards enhance motion. Engineered wood counters that a little bit, however do not push sizes past what the space can hide. A 220 millimeter board in a 2.7 meter wide terrace corridor can feel like a deck. In little areas, a 150 to 180 millimeter slab commonly reads calmer. Laminate and hybrid can go vast without structural fine, yet see pattern rep. Many boards share print collections and if you lay without interest, the eye captures twins.

Color impacts maintenance. Pale floorings hide dirt however reveal dark scuffs. Dark discolorations reveal dust yet hide coffee drips. In Melbourne's winter months light, very dark walnut can suck the life out of a room unless you combine it with cozy walls and soft coatings. Golden-haired oaks lug Scandinavian calmness, yet in late mid-day sunlight they can mirror glow. Identified gum tissue's character can battle with hectic kitchen areas. Bring genuine samples to the house and enjoy them for a couple of days at different times. Your retina will certainly tell you greater than a showroom ever before could.

Budget, genuine and total

Look beyond the square meter sticker. A floor layer's quote covers removal, prep, products, trims, stairways, garbage disposal, and sometimes subfloor surprises. If a laminate rests at 35 to 50 dollars per square meter for material and a crossbreed at 45 to 70, wood boards may range from 80 to 150 before finish and labor. Installment can double the material cost on a glue-down hardwood due to the fact that it takes some time and expert adhesives. Padding can include 5 to 20 per square meter relying on acoustic efficiency. Wetness barriers, leveling substances, and stairway nosings each have a number.

The running cost matters as well. Hardwood can be revitalized at year 10 or fifteen with a light sand and layer for a portion of substitute. Laminate and hybrid will appear like new till they don't, after that desire changing in entire or large areas. That can straighten with a remodelling cycle, which is why capitalists often choose laminate or crossbreed. Owner-occupiers who dream in timber often tend to value the repairability and the way real timber sets the tone for the rest of the house.

Installation techniques that divide amateur from professional

Click systems altered the profession. They allow you drift floors fast and without glue fumes. However every system has resistances. Draw a click joint also hard and you compromise the lock. Neglect development spaces at wall surfaces and your floor becomes an accordion. A poor cut around a blog post looks fine under a fat grain of silicone till the initial hot day closes the void in other places and the silicone gives way, exposing the sin.

Glue-down requires clean pieces, the correct notch trowel, and respect for open time. Work also fast and you trap ridges, which call hollow underfoot. Job too slow and the adhesive skins, which eliminates bond strength. Staging belongs to the craft, selecting where to start so the last board at a doorway lands full or near full width. The eye catches bit cuts and it decreases the regarded high quality even if every little thing else is perfect.

Stairs subject the craft, always. A solid wood tread, mitred returns that close tight, nosings that align by feel as well as by degree, and constant riser heights that fulfill code and rhythm. Laminates and hybrids on stairways require devoted nosings that are repaired mechanically and adhesively. Skimp there and you produce a tripping threat. I recommend real wood on treads where feasible also if the rest of the home is hybrid. The hand, foot, and eye linger on stairs. They are entitled to better.
